complex_number.java

来自「快速傅立叶变换算法的实现」· Java 代码 · 共 32 行

JAVA
32
字号
package ex4_fast_fourier_transform;

public class Complex_number {
	double real;
	double imagi;

	public Complex_number() {
		real = 0;
		imagi = 0;
	}

	public Complex_number(double x, double y) {
		real = x;
		imagi = y;
	}

	public Complex_number add(Complex_number a) {
		Complex_number c = new Complex_number();
		c.real = a.real + real;
		c.imagi = a.imagi + imagi;
		return c;
	}

	public Complex_number mult(Complex_number a) {
		Complex_number c = new Complex_number();
		c.real = a.real * real - a.imagi * imagi;
		c.imagi = a.real * imagi + real * a.imagi;
		return c;
	}

}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?